AgriFlow: SaaS for Efficient Farm Management
Introducing "AgriFlow," a vertical SaaS platform designed for small to mid-sized farms that streamlines crop management and supply chain logistics. It addresses the challenges of inefficient resource allocation and market access by providing real-time data analytics, automated reporting, and a marketplace for direct sales to consumers and retailers. What makes AgriFlow unique is its integration of IoT devices for precision agriculture, enabling farmers to optimize yields while minimizing waste, all within a user-friendly interface tailored specifically for the agricultural sector.

Competition Analysis
Score: 65/100
There are several established players in the agtech sector offering similar solutions. Competitors include companies like FarmLogs and Granular, which provide farm management software with varying degrees of IoT integration.
FarmLogs
Farm management software that tracks field activities and finances.
Strengths: Established brand, Comprehensive feature set
Weaknesses: Higher cost, Complex UI
Granular
Cloud-based farm management software with precision ag tools.
Strengths: Strong analytics, Good customer support
Weaknesses: Expensive for small farms, Limited direct market sales features
